There are a number of foreign exchange student programs in the US. One of the leading programs is AFS Intercultural Programs USA which has been running for 65 years. They provide help for students going abroad and people wishing to host a foreign student. Full details are available on their extensive website.

The method to determine the "best" foreign exchange student program will vary as widely as there are programs and exchange students. I will attempt to present several factors that should be considered when determining the best. * How long has the program been around? * What type of organization is the program - foundation, trust, company, etc.? * Does the program have a "web presence" such that information about the company and its programs be quickly accessed? * How many foreign partners does the program have? * Does the program handle Department of State grants? * What benefits does the program provide to Host Schools? * Is the program full listed by the CSIET Board of Directors (who encourage organizations to administer their foreign exchange programs according to the highest possible standards and to permit the Evaluation Committee to accurately and fairly reflect its conclusions - as of 4/2009 there were 68 such programs). See http://www.csiet.org/publications-resources/publications/listings.html * Does the program provide extensive resources available to the hosting school and host family? These are just a few factors. One big factor to consider no matter which program you consider is personality of the host family and the foreign exchange student. No matter how good a program may be, if the "fit" is wrong, the experience will not come anywhere close to how rewarding the experience should be.
